On Thu, Jan 27, 2005 at 04:01:34PM +1100, Daniel Carosone wrote:
> Another datapoint on my older latitude c600, just because I felt like
> trying it even though I didn't expect it to work.
> 
> S1 seems to almost work, in that the laptop 'freezes' and the power
> light goes to a slow blink.  It does not switch off the display,
> however, so I'm looking at the frozen screen contents until I press
> the power button to resume - at which point the display and backlight
> power off as everything else comes on again. Switching VT's brings the
> display back, and everything is fine from then on, except for the
> esa(4) which has no powerhooks yet.

The lack of powermanagement code in esa should not matter here since
all S1 suspend does is halt the CPU.  Odd.
 
> S2 seems to have no effect at all.

AFAIK no one implements this mode, even if it's defined in spec.
 
> S3 seems to power everything except the backlight off (the LCD panel
> is off, but I get a bright white background).  Powering on again I see
> the previous screen contents for a fraction of a second before the
> machine reboots.
